Modern Elegance with House of Harvey Co.

We talked with Event Stylist Gretel, from House of Harvey Co about the inspiration behind this styled wedding shoot at Byron Bay, the two stunning looks created and got the inside info on the details of the design. 

Q: Can you briefly describe your business, your style and the services you provide?  

A: House of Harvey co. is a one stop shop for all types of Events. We provide a range of event services such as Catering, Bar Service, Event Hire & Styling. Our brand style is modern, clean and simplistic, yet effortlessly elegant.

Q: What was your inspiration and vision behind the styling for this shoot?
A: We had a range of looks to execute on this shoot. We wanted to demonstrate versatility amongst our range, and the different types of tablescapes that could be created. One style was very feminine and elegant, with very pink tones, peach and nude candles and soft textures. Another look we also did was a more monochrome setting, with dark candles, cutlery and plates, matched with crystal cut glassware, softened with silk underlays for each plate.

Q: Tell us about the key elements of this shoot and how it came about?   

A: The key elements of this shoot were featuring our range of tableware. We were fortunate enough to shoot at Temple Farm House in Nashua, so we didn't really need to do much to the space, but set the table. We were pretty rushed to get it done, as it was in between two lock downs last year, so as much as we would've loved to have included a florist and stationery designer to really elevate the content created, we very much did a DIY job. Our photographer was Grace Elizabeth Images.
